What is the cheapest month to fly from Melbourne Airport to Okinawa?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Melbourne Airport to Okinawa,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Melbourne Airport to Okinawa is May, where tickets cost $1,040 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and April,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$2,011 and $1,370 respectively.

  • Which airline alliances offer flights from Melbourne to Okinawa?

    SkyTeam, and oneworld are the airline alliances operating flights between Melbourne and Okinawa, with SkyTeam being the most commonly used for this route.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Melbourne to Okinawa?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ional return ticket. You could then fly to Okinawa with an airline and back to Melbourne with another airline.
